ios - 顶部导航无法正常显示 - iPhone 应用程序也必须在 iPhone 分辨率和 2X iPhone 3GS 分辨率下未经修改地在 iPad 上运行

标签 ios iphone swift ipad

我的应用程序仅适用于 iPhone,并且在 iPhone 设备上运行良好。它被苹果拒绝并显示以下消息:

iPhone Apps must also run on iPad without modification, at iPhone
resolution, and at 2X iPhone 3GS resolution

当我在 iPad 上运行我的应用程序时,它会剪切顶部导航器的一部分。附上丝网打印品。

有人知道如何修复它吗? enter image description here

最佳答案

我认为你的导航栏被覆盖了,因为它的位置低于为状态栏保留的20点。要检查其位置,请单击导航项或栏,转到“尺寸检查器”,然后在“ View ”下,您将看到 X 和 Y 位置。或者您可以为其设置约束。我希望这会有所帮助。

关于ios - 顶部导航无法正常显示 - iPhone 应用程序也必须在 iPhone 分辨率和 2X iPhone 3GS 分辨率下未经修改地在 iPad 上运行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30894376/

相关文章:

ios - Flutter 启动 iOS 应用程序时显示黑屏

iphone - 关于CGPoint的内存管理

iphone - 按照教程中的说明调用FBSession.activeSession会导致NSException

javascript - 试图将 JS 脚本移植到 Swift,但计算不正确

ios - 在 iOS 上每 n 秒执行一次连接检查

ios - 火力地堡 : How to get email from sign in with apple on real device?

ios - 设置线帽样式不起作用 UIBezierPath

iphone - AFNetworking为POST请求设置默认值

ios - 编译 Swift 源文件卡在 xcode 7.3.1

ios - 在 Objective-C 中找不到 Swift AppDelegate